An established, multi-specialty dental practice in a busy 9-operatory office (20+ staff) is looking for a dependable, permanent Experienced Dental Administrator/ Treatment Coordinator . Working alongside a dedicated front-desk team, this role focuses on schedule optimization, hygiene coordination, insurance processing, and presenting general and specialty (Ortho, Perio, Endo) treatment plans to patients . It’s an exceptional, long-term fit for an articulate multi-tasker with a cheerful attitude and strong communication skills.

Requirements & Skills Needed

Experience: Minimum 1 year as a dental administratorand treatment coordinator with a desire to learn.

Technical Knowledge: Proficient with Dentrix , familiarity with GP and specialty procedures (Ortho, Perio, Endo) , and expertise handling insurance, pre-determinations, and financial estimates.

Communication: Flawless English (verbal and written) with excellent phone etiquette and patient-facing presentation skills.

Certifications: Valid CPR (candidate-funded) plus WHMIS, Health & Safety, Accessibility, and Workplace Violence & Harassment certifications required prior to start (free training links provided).

Key Traits: Highly organized, detail-oriented, reliable, and results-driven with a positive demeanor.
